autumn hikes in shenandoah

today was a perfect autumn day for hiking- cool clear and beautiful blue skies. we are still trying to mark off trails on the map, but is getting harder to choose from what is left (so many are too long, too short, or just too hard to do without multiple cars). today we hiked the mt marshall trail which i would recommend simply for the scenic mountain vistas. we of course looped it with a few others for a very long (13.6) but generally pretty flat hike. you may wonder what we talk about for 5 hours (yes we set a record pace due to the relatively even terrain) and today we mentally built our dream house with detached ginormous garage for aaron's fun cars and vehicle lift. it's a good way to spend a few sunshine-y hours. and then we looked at all the houses for sale on the way home, ;) we're just speculating for fun but as we learned with the wedding, it comes in handy when the real deal
